Quote:
Originally Posted by Reuben View Post
Turris, Kyle.

Your thoughts on his output this season and down the road.

Thanks
Similar to last year. Depends on quality of wingers, which should get a lot better in coming years.

I foresee a 20 goal, 50-55 point season.

Down the road... 25-30 goals, 60-70 points.

Quote:
Originally Posted by The Wrong Marine View Post
Hey Angus,

Which prospects do you see this lockout helping the most and which prospects do you think are hurt most?
Off the top of my head. Helps:

Schultz, Kassian, Connauton, Schroeder, Yakupov, Strome (big time), Huberdeau, etc. Essentially any prospect forced to play in the AHL or CHL vs. NHL. Some time to build confidence is huge.

Hurts.... to be honest not sure this really "hurts" any prospect. Some veterans get hurt as they lose precious prime playing years.
